Understanding the Azure Basic Fundamentals: A Comprehensive Introduction to Microsoft’s Cloud Platform

Azure Basic Fundamentals

Azure Basic Fundamentals

Microsoft Azure is a powerful cloud computing platform that provides a wide range of services to help individuals and businesses build, deploy, and manage applications and services through Microsoft-managed data centers. Whether you are new to cloud computing or have some experience, understanding the basic fundamentals of Azure is essential for leveraging its capabilities effectively.

What is Azure?

Azure is a comprehensive set of cloud services that offers solutions for computing power, storage, networking, databases, analytics, artificial intelligence (AI), Internet of Things (IoT), and more. It allows you to build, deploy, and scale applications quickly while reducing costs and complexity.

Key Concepts

To grasp the basic fundamentals of Azure, it’s important to familiarize yourself with some key concepts:

  1. Virtual Machines (VMs): Azure provides virtual machines that allow you to run applications in the cloud without the need for physical hardware. VMs offer flexibility in terms of operating systems and configurations.
  2. Storage: Azure offers various storage options such as Blob storage for unstructured data like images or documents, Table storage for NoSQL key-value data, Queue storage for reliable messaging between components, and File storage for file-based workloads.
  3. Networking: Azure provides virtual networks to connect your resources securely. You can also create subnets, implement network security groups (NSGs) for access control, and establish virtual private networks (VPNs) for secure connections between your on-premises infrastructure and Azure.
  4. Databases: Azure offers a range of database services, including Azure SQL Database for relational data, Azure Cosmos DB for globally distributed NoSQL databases, and Azure Database for MySQL and PostgreSQL for open-source database solutions.
  5. App Services: Azure App Service allows you to quickly build, deploy, and scale web applications, mobile app backends, and RESTful APIs. It supports various programming languages and frameworks.

Benefits of Using Azure

Azure provides numerous benefits that make it a popular choice among individuals and organizations:

  • Scalability: Azure allows you to scale your resources up or down based on demand. This flexibility ensures that you only pay for what you use.
  • Reliability: Microsoft’s extensive network of data centers ensures high availability and redundancy. Your applications and data are protected against failures.
  • Security: Azure has built-in security features to protect your applications and data. It offers advanced threat detection, identity management, encryption, and compliance certifications.
  • Ease of Use: With its user-friendly interface and comprehensive documentation, Azure makes it easy for developers to get started quickly.
  • Ecosystem Integration: Azure integrates seamlessly with other Microsoft products such as Office 365, Dynamics 365, and Power BI. This integration enables a unified experience across various platforms.

3. Learn about Azure regions and availability zones for high availability.

When exploring Azure’s basic fundamentals, it is crucial to learn about Azure regions and availability zones for achieving high availability. Azure regions are geographical areas where Azure resources are hosted, and each region consists of multiple data centers. By distributing your resources across different regions, you can ensure redundancy and protect against potential failures in a specific location. Availability zones, on the other hand, are unique physical locations within an Azure region that have independent power, cooling, and networking infrastructure. By deploying resources across availability zones, you can achieve even higher levels of fault tolerance and resilience. Understanding these concepts will help you design and implement robust architectures that can withstand disruptions and provide uninterrupted services to your users.

4. Use resource groups to organize and manage your Azure resources efficiently.

When working with Azure, it is crucial to utilize resource groups effectively to organize and manage your Azure resources efficiently. Resource groups act as logical containers that allow you to group related resources together for easier management and organization. By using resource groups, you can streamline tasks such as provisioning, monitoring, and securing your resources. They provide a convenient way to manage access control and apply policies consistently across multiple resources. Additionally, resource groups enable you to track costs and optimize resource usage effectively. By leveraging this fundamental concept of Azure, you can ensure a well-structured and organized environment for your cloud deployments.

5. Implement proper security measures, such as role-based access control (RBAC) and network security groups (NSGs).

When working with Azure, it is crucial to implement proper security measures to protect your applications and data. Two essential security measures to consider are role-based access control (RBAC) and network security groups (NSGs). RBAC allows you to assign specific roles and permissions to users, ensuring that only authorized individuals have access to resources. NSGs, on the other hand, enable you to define firewall rules and control inbound and outbound traffic at the network level. By implementing RBAC and NSGs, you can enhance the security of your Azure environment and mitigate potential risks.

6. Monitor your Azure resources using tools like Azure Monitor and Application Insights.

Monitoring your Azure resources is a crucial aspect of managing your cloud infrastructure effectively. By utilizing tools like Azure Monitor and Application Insights, you gain valuable insights into the performance, availability, and usage of your resources. Azure Monitor allows you to collect and analyze telemetry data from various sources, enabling you to detect issues, set up alerts, and optimize resource utilization. Application Insights focuses specifically on monitoring the performance and behavior of your applications, providing detailed metrics and diagnostics. By leveraging these monitoring tools, you can proactively identify and address any issues that may impact the performance or availability of your Azure resources, ensuring a smooth and reliable experience for your users.

8. Explore automation options with tools like Azure PowerShell or Azure CLI for efficient management of resources.

When diving into Azure basic fundamentals, it is crucial to explore automation options for efficient resource management. Tools like Azure PowerShell and Azure CLI offer powerful capabilities that allow users to automate various tasks and streamline their workflows. With Azure PowerShell, you can write scripts and commandlets to manage and provision Azure resources programmatically. Similarly, Azure CLI provides a command-line interface that enables you to interact with Azure services through commands. By leveraging these automation tools, users can save time, ensure consistency, and efficiently manage their resources in the Azure environment.

What skills does a Microsoft 365 Enterprise Administrator Expert possess?

A Microsoft 365 Enterprise Administrator Expert possesses a wide range of skills to effectively manage and deploy Microsoft 365 services within an enterprise environment. Some key skills include:

  1. Microsoft 365 Services Knowledge: Expertise in understanding and configuring various Microsoft 365 services such as Exchange Online, SharePoint Online, OneDrive, Teams, and more. This includes managing user accounts, permissions, data storage, and collaboration features.
  2. Identity Management: Proficiency in implementing and managing identity solutions using Azure Active Directory (AAD). This involves setting up user authentication, single sign-on (SSO), multi-factor authentication (MFA), and managing identity synchronization.
  3. Security Implementation: Ability to implement robust security measures within the Microsoft 365 environment. This includes configuring security policies, data loss prevention (DLP) settings, encryption methods, and utilizing tools like Azure Information Protection (AIP) and Advanced Threat Protection (ATP) to safeguard sensitive data.
  4. Compliance Management: Understanding compliance requirements and ensuring adherence to regulations such as GDPR or HIPAA within the Microsoft 365 ecosystem. This includes managing retention policies, eDiscovery capabilities, legal holds, and auditing features.
  5. PowerShell Proficiency: Familiarity with PowerShell scripting language for automating administrative tasks and troubleshooting issues within the Microsoft 365 environment.
  6. User Productivity Tools Configuration: Skill in configuring and customizing user productivity tools like Teams to meet organizational requirements for communication, collaboration, and project management.
  7. Monitoring and Troubleshooting: Ability to monitor the health of Microsoft 365 services using tools like Microsoft 365 Admin Center or third-party monitoring solutions. Skilled in diagnosing issues related to service availability or performance degradation and resolving them promptly.
  8. Deployment Planning: Expertise in evaluating organizational needs, planning migrations from on-premises systems to Microsoft 365 services, and executing deployment plans efficiently while minimizing disruption.
  9. Continuous Learning: A commitment to staying updated with the latest developments and updates in the Microsoft 365 ecosystem, including new features, security enhancements, and best practices.
  10. Communication and Collaboration: Strong communication skills to effectively interact with stakeholders, understand their requirements, and provide guidance on leveraging Microsoft 365 services to meet business objectives. Additionally, the ability to collaborate with cross-functional teams to drive successful adoption of Microsoft 365 technologies.

These skills collectively enable a Microsoft 365 Enterprise Administrator Expert to effectively manage and optimize the Microsoft 365 environment, ensuring seamless integration, enhanced productivity, and robust security within an organization.
